The Internet is also ideal for job hunting. Here is a practical use that you may not have given much thought before. Surely you've thought of the Internet as a way to spend money through online shopping, but have you considered that you can use the Internet to make money, i.e. to find a job? The Internet provides several websites that can help you find the perfect job. What you do is upload your resume and send it out to companies that interest you. You can research businesses and receive helpful pointers and tips for interviews. It saves you the time and headaches job searching that existed before the Internet. Now, you upload your information, send it to all the positions that interest you, and then check back regularly to see if you have any word. Here again, high speed Internet is ideal since you will be downloading and uploading a lot of information online while submitted information and browsing job openings.
